Along with uncovering this dastardly plot you must also heal your injured pet Dragon, train as a wizard yourself, speak with some of the local Rabbit, Elephant and Mosquito people,visit an off world casino, and defeat enemies with your magical ball. In it you played as Twinsen, hero of the planet Twinsun (already a little confusing) - which has been invaded by some suspicious aliens that are kidnapping the planet's children and wizards.

This was a 3D adventure game for the PC from French developers Adeline Software and the follow up to the original Little Big Adventure, also known as Relentless.
